Badminton Equipment
 Rackets- the rackets are make of wood. Contemporary racquets are made of different materials
such as carbon fiber, aluminum, steel or titanium. The weight of the rackets is about 70-100
grams. Most executive players use special wrapping on the racket handle ( grip), which bring the
athletes to attain the best control.

 Shuttlecock- There are two types of shuttlecocks: plastic ones and the ones with natural feathers.
Plastic shuttlecocks are more appropriate for amateurs and some types of training. A plastic
shuttlecock consists of a cork or synthetic head and a plastic ‘skirt’ attached to it. The feather
shuttlecock is made of 16 goose feathers.

 Badminton Shoes- Badminton shoes have serious lateral support of the ankle, which block the
ankles, from tuckling in with a sharp change of direction and lunges.

Badminton Court Dimensions and Net Height( Facilities)


The Badminton court is a rectangular shape. The general dimensions of a badminton court is 20 feet by 44
feet. For a doubles game, the width of the court should be 20 feet. The net is installed at a height of 5.1
feet; the height of the net in the center is limited above by a strip of 0.25 feet, which is folded in half.
Another issential pat of the court is the markup. The width of the marking lines is 4 centimeters. At a
distance of 6,5 feet from the grid .there is the service line and the backline , there is the service zone. The

Badminton Officials
 Referee- the referee is the most require officials of the whole tournament. He or she is responsible
of the competition and require that the tournament is initiate the laws of badminton including
court, rackets and shuttlecock measurement.
 Umpire- the umpire is responsible in particular match and it is in charge of the court. It is the
umpire responsibility to judge service faults and other players fault. The umpire keeps a record of
any misbehavior or incident and reports it to the referee. Keeping the match score .
 Service Judge- The service judge has power for making a service fault call and to provide
shuttles to the player.
 Line Judge- the line judges are responsible for designating whether a shuttlecock landed ‘in’ or
‘out’ if the shuttles lands near the lines he/she assigned to control.
